Iranian oil exports to China fell by approximately 200,000 barrels per day from March to April, according to industry consultants, likely due to a higher volume of competing Russian oil exports to Asia. China, the main destination of Iranian oil exports, began buying heavily discounted Russian oil at triple its previous rate, after Western countries imposed sanctions on Russia. Russian crude oil is usually cheaper to refine than Iranian crude. Approximately 20 Iranian tankers carrying nearly 40 million barrels of oil have been left anchored near Singapore searching for buyers, according to shipping data and estimates by the analytics company Kpler.
